目录
一、创建shell脚本
二、查看当前的路径
三、执行脚本
一、创建shell脚本
shell脚本的特点
提前将可执行的命令语句写入一个文件中
顺序执行
解释器逐行解释代码
常见的脚本有:shell、python、PHP......
注:用什么解释器就是什么脚本
编写shell脚本:
步骤:
1、新建文件
2、添加可执行语句命令
3、给文件添加执行权限
如下:
创建一个存放脚本的文件夹
mkdir /root/shell/day01
创建脚本并写入内容
vim /root/shell/day01/first.sh
echo "Hello World"
赋于执行权限
chmod +x /root/shell/day01/first.sh
执行文件(我是在文件所在路径打开的终端所以直接执行的 写绝对路径执行哦)
./first.sh
规范脚本
#!脚本声明 例如:#!/bin/bash
注释信息以#开头
可执行的语句
二、查看当前的路径
pwd
三、执行脚本
方法1:需要可执行权限
相对路径和绝对路径都可以
添加执行权限
chmod +x 文件路径/文件名
取消可执行权限:chmod -x 文件路径/文件名
方法2:不具有可执行权限
sh 文件名 #该执行方法默认开启了子进程
source 文件名 #该执行方法不会启动子进程,通过pstree可以查看进程树
为了检测两种执行方式的区别,我们可以在脚本中写入exit
sh:退出子进程,返回命令行 看起来没有变化文章来源:https://www.toymoban.com/news/detail-450669.html
source:退出脚本 直接断开文章来源地址https://www.toymoban.com/news/detail-450669.html
到了这里,关于【Linux命令-shell】虚拟机中创建shell脚本、查看当前路径、执行脚本的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!